WebDiabetic retinopathy (DR) involves progressive neurovascular degeneration of the retina. Reduction in synaptic protein expression has been observed in retinas from several diabetic animal models and human retinas. We previously reported that the topical administration (eye drops) of sitagliptin, a dipeptidyl peptidase-4 (DPP-4) inhibitor, prevented retinal …

WebJul 8, 2024 · Too much VEGF can also cause blood vessels to grow abnormally, which could damage the eye. Anti-VEGF drugs block VEGF and can improve vision. Your eye doctor may prescribe anti-VEGF injections if you have: Diabetic retinopathy ; Macular edema from various retinovascular diseases, including diabetic macular edema (DME) … WebType 1 and Type 2 diabetics are especially prone to eye disease. Web14 hours ago · A total of 6 studies were evaluated that looked at efficacy of eye drops in patients with diabetic retinopathy. Of these studies, 4 were randomized clinical trials. Mondal et al (2004) assessed 0.1% brimonidine (versus placebo) in patients with very mild non-proliferative diabetic retinopathy.

Symptoms of diabetes-related retinopathy include: Blurred or distorted vision. New color blindness or seeing colors as faded. Poor night vision ( night blindness ). Small dark spots ( eye floaters) or streaks in your vision.
